3-(Chloromethyl)-5-(2-methylpropyl)isoxazole

Description:
3-(Chloromethyl)-5-(2-methylpropyl)isoxazole is a chemical compound characterized by its isoxazole ring, which is a five-membered heterocyclic structure containing both nitrogen and oxygen atoms. The presence of a chloromethyl group at the 3-position and a branched alkyl group (2-methylpropyl) at the 5-position contributes to its unique reactivity and potential applications in organic synthesis and medicinal chemistry. This compound may exhibit properties such as moderate to high lipophilicity due to the alkyl substituent, which can influence its solubility and permeability in biological systems. Additionally, the chloromethyl group can serve as a reactive site for further chemical modifications, making it a versatile intermediate in the synthesis of more complex molecules. The compound's specific reactivity, stability, and potential biological activity would depend on its structural features and the functional groups present. As with many organic compounds, safety and handling precautions should be observed due to the presence of chlorine, which can pose health risks.
Formula:C8H12ClNO
InChI:InChI=1S/C8H12ClNO/c1-6(2)3-8-4-7(5-9)10-11-8/h4,6H,3,5H2,1-2H3
InChI key:InChIKey=BGVAJYBLQVTTGU-UHFFFAOYSA-N
SMILES:C(C(C)C)C1=CC(CCl)=NO1
Synonyms:
  • Isoxazole, 3-(chloromethyl)-5-(2-methylpropyl)-
  • 3-Chloromethyl-5-isobutyl-isoxazole
  • 3-(Chloromethyl)-5-(2-methylpropyl)isoxazole
